Clariant achieves 100% green electricity consumption at Knapsack production site

Clariant’s additives production facility in Knapsack, Germany powers the production of its halogen-free Exolit flame retardants solely with 100% renewable electricity. 
(Photo: Clariant)Clariant will continue to power its BU Additives production facility in Knapsack, Germany, solely with 100% renewable electricity following the site’s successful pilot switch one year ago. This underlines Clariant’s continued efforts of shifting to the use of renewables for its electricity demand, lowering the impact on climate change.

Henkel introduces new tin replacement solution for automotive body repair

Teroson EP 5020 is easy to apply and results in a smooth substrate for subsequent filling and painting. 
(Photo: Henkel, PR073)Henkel has introduced Teroson EP 5020 TR, a two-component epoxy-based cold rebuilding material designed to replace conventional tin solder in aftermarket repairs of automotive body damages. Fast curing, easier to sand and smoother to apply than previous solutions, the material also eliminates the heat and open flame process required for tin soldered repairs.

Milliken & Company Finalizes Acquisition of Borchers

Milliken & Company Milliken & Company (“Milliken”), a global diversified manufacturer with more than a century and a half of materials science expertise, has formally acquired Borchers Group Limited (“Borchers”), a global specialty chemicals company known for its innovative high-performance coating additives and specialty catalyst solutions from The Jordan Company, L.P. (“TJC”). The transaction officially closed on Tuesday, January 28, 2020.

Mondi’s BarrierPack Recyclable helps consumer goods brands advance their circular economy goals

Mondi’s BarrierPack Recyclable helps consumer goods brands advance their circular economy goals. 
(Photos: Mondi, PR143)Mondi, global leader in sustainable packaging and paper, had its award-winning BarrierPack Recyclable all-polyethylene film certified for recyclability. This lightweight mono-material offers a more sustainable packaging solution for diverse applications ranging from stand-up pouches for dishwasher tablets to resealable pouches for organic dog food.

TE Connectivity further extends M12 range with right-angle connectors for PCBs and panels

TE Connectivity further extends M12 range with right-angle connectors for PCBs and panels. 
(Source: TE Connectivity, PR312)TE Connectivity (TE), a world leader in connectivity and sensors, is once again expanding its M12 portfolio, with A-, B- and D-coded versions of the right-angle connector. The new products come just a few months after TE introduced connectors with eight and 12 pin positions for direct mounting onto PCBs and panels.

New technology for a new laboratory: Clariant Refinery Services opens state-of-the-art crude and fuel oil lab in the UK

New technology for a new laboratory: Clariant Refinery Services opens state-of-the-art crude and fuel oil lab in the UK. (Photo: Clariant)Clariant Refinery Services, a global leader in developing additives for better fuel transportation, has opened a new state-of-the-art crude and fuel oil laboratory that will focus on applications for transport and storage. Based in Bradford, United Kingdom, this global center of excellence will support a highly experienced technical services team equipped to address multiple challenges experienced by refineries, storage terminals, pipeline providers, and logistic companies all around the world.
